Recortar imagen
Recorte una imagen en el navegador con área arrastrable, campos numéricos, proporciones predefinidas y exportación según el formato.
Haga clic o arrastre una imagen aquí
PNG, JPEG, WebP · Máx. 10MBRecortar imagen
Esta herramienta recorta una imagen PNG, JPEG o WebP directamente en el navegador. Arrastre o cambie el tamaño del área de recorte, elija una proporción predefinida o escriba coordenadas exactas en píxeles.
El archivo original permanece en su dispositivo. La exportación de Canvas conserva PNG, JPEG o WebP cuando el navegador admite ese formato, y usa PNG como alternativa si es necesario.
El recorte libre sirve para selecciones arbitrarias; las proporciones 1:1, 4:3 y 16:9 ayudan con vistas sociales, miniaturas y tamaños de documentos.
como usar
- Suba una imagen PNG, JPEG o WebP.
- Arrastre el área de recorte, cambie su tamaño desde los controles, elija una proporción o escriba valores exactos.
- Ajuste la calidad JPEG/WebP, revise la salida y descargue la imagen recortada.
Cuándo recortar imágenes
Recorte imágenes para quitar bordes no deseados, enfocar el sujeto o encajar proporciones fijas para tarjetas, miniaturas y vistas sociales.
Use campos numéricos exactos cuando un diseño o CMS requiera un recorte específico en píxeles.
Recortar con Canvas
El navegador usa coordenadas de origen en Canvas drawImage:
const canvas = document.createElement('canvas');
canvas.width = crop.width;
canvas.height = crop.height;
const ctx = canvas.getContext('2d');
ctx.drawImage(image, crop.x, crop.y, crop.width, crop.height, 0, 0, crop.width, crop.height);
canvas.toBlob(saveBlob, outputMime, quality);Integración MCP
MCP (Model Context Protocol) permite que agentes de IA y aplicaciones descubran y ejecuten utilidades de Coding.Tools para flujos repetibles de conversión, formato, hash y generación.
Nombre de herramienta MCP: image-crop
Endpoint MCP: https://coding.tools/mcp
Llame primero a tools/list. Cada herramienta incluye inputSchema, outputSchema y examples para que un agente de IA o cliente pueda construir argumentos válidos sin adivinar.
Para tools/call, lea result.content[0].text para el valor visible y result.structuredContent para el análisis automático. Los fallos de herramienta devuelven isError: true; los fallos de protocolo devuelven un JSON-RPC error.
Ejemplo de solicitud tools/call:
curl -s https://coding.tools/mcp \
-H "Content-Type: application/json" \
-H "Accept: application/json" \
-H "MCP-Protocol-Version: 2025-06-18" \
-d '{"jsonrpc":"2.0","id":1,"method":"tools/call","params":{"name":"image-crop","arguments":{}}}'
Esta herramienta de imagen es solo para navegador en MCP. tools/call no procesa bytes de imagen locales en el servidor; devuelve isError: true y un resource_link a la interfaz web.
La mayoría de las herramientas de texto y datos aceptan una cadena input y options opcionales. Las herramientas de imagen que dependen de las API de imagen del navegador se listan para descubrimiento y devuelven un enlace a la interfaz web cuando necesitan capacidades del navegador.